Jamshedpur, Nov 18: In the Parsudih police station area, a wedding celebration turned into mourning on Sunday when a person who had come to attend his nephew’s wedding, died after coming into contact with a live wire.
Preparations were underway at Sanjay Prasad’s house for his son’s pre-wedding ceremony scheduled for Monday. Prem Kumar (35) who was helping with electrical work at the house, accidentally came in contact with a live wire. He was rushed to Tata Main Hospital, where doctors declared him dead on arrival. “It was a tragic accident. We never expected the wedding celebrations to turn into such a sad event,” said a family member.
Witnesses reported that after receiving the electric shock, Prem Kumar fell onto a stone, suffering severe head injuries. Prem Kumar is survived by three children and was a farmer from Rohtas district in Bihar. On Monday, after the post-mortem was completed, the body was handed over to the family.
